BNP Standing Committee member and Chattogram-11 (Bandar-Patenga) candidate Amir Khasru Mahmud Chowdhury said Bangladesh has returned to a democratic path, citing the festive presence of voters across polling centers. He made the remarks on Thursday at noon after casting his vote at the North Kattali Munshipara Government Primary School center in Chattogram.

Speaking to journalists, Khasru stated that voters were actively participating in a celebratory atmosphere and that similar scenes were being reported nationwide. He said this turnout proved that the democratic process had been restored in the country. Khasru added that people have always trusted the BNP during critical times and expressed confidence that voters would again choose the party’s symbol, the paddy sheaf, to reclaim ownership of the country.

He further noted that the return of democracy had come at a high cost to pro-democracy political activists, students, and citizens. Khasru honored the sacrifices of BNP members and said voters would elect qualified representatives through ballots. He also mentioned that no complaints had been raised against the administration by midday.
